Madison Leyens, Class of 2014

Southern Methodist University
Madison Leyens follows a calling to deepen her faith and to bring the joy of following this mission to her peers at Southern Methodist University.

Madison is heavily involved in her campus’s Catholic Center. You can even catch her having the occasional 2:00 AM theological discussion in her dorm room. Her faith-filled mission has incarnated most recently in creating deeply thoughtful liturgical art and entrance to a conversation among creatives in the Catholic community about bringing a new artistic Renaissance to the Church.

When asked how SGCS inspired her, she says “The first verse of the SGCS school song beautifully captures what I am aspiring to do in exercising my passions and in following my unique callings.” These unique callings also include pursuing a Business Management Major and Minors in Creative Computing and Mandarin Chinese.

She goes on to say, “During arguably the most formative years of my childhood, the opportunity to be in a community that was dedicated to hold true Catholic identity at the forefront of its actions to the best of its ability and was full of adults who were so committed to my holistic outcome--spiritually, mentally, emotionally, and physically--was the most incredible gift.”
